Inclusion criteria

Inclusion criteria: All patients between 18-65 years with euthyroid goitre/or made euthyroid that will attend Bulamu healthcare camps during the study period.

Exclusion criteria

Exclusion criteria: All patients with grade 3 goitre, retrosternal goitres, goitres with features of infiltration to surrounding tissues, obesity, previous neck surgeries and diabetes mellitus.

Design outcomes

Primary

MeasureTime frame
1.Early post operative complications (post operative pain, SSI, hematoma formation, paralysis of recurrent laryngeal nerve, vomiting and nausea with 24 hours, voice changes, symptomatic hypocalcemia) 2.Cost of treatment 3.Patient’s degree of satisfaction
